The Lamborghini Huracán STO — Super Trofeo Omologata — is the closest thing to a race car that Lamborghini will sell you with a number plate. Built from the one-make race series, it takes the 5.2-litre naturally-aspirated V10 (640 PS), sends every horse to the rear wheels only, and wraps it in a carbon-fibre body with a giant fixed wing and the signature "cofango" one-piece front clamshell. It is loud, raw and utterly focused — a car that turns a Dubai evening into an event.
Unlike the all-wheel-drive Huracán EVO, the STO is rear-wheel drive and track-bred: sharper, lighter (around 1,339 kg dry) and more theatrical. 0–100 km/h takes about 3.0 seconds and it screams to 8,500 rpm with a naturally-aspirated howl no turbo car can match. The STO is rear-wheel drive, lighter and track-focused, with a fixed rear wing, carbon bodywork and a more aggressive setup. The EVO is all-wheel drive and a little more forgiving day-to-day. The STO is the more extreme, driver-focused car.
It can be driven on the road, but the STO is firm and focused by design. For relaxed daily use many renters prefer the Huracán EVO or the Urus; the STO shines on an evening blast or a special occasion.
